Recipe Ingredients

You’ll need the following ingredients to make this fish burger:

Fish burger ingredients.
  • Fish: Choose fish that holds its shape well when cooked. I used aji, or Japanese horse mackerel, for this recipe, but you can also use cod, salmon, or another firm fish.
  • Flour, eggs, and panko: These three ingredients create the crispy coating for the fish.
  • Oil: Use a neutral oil suitable for pan-frying.
  • Egg mayo sauce: This simple sauce is made with boiled eggs, mayonnaise, vinegar, sugar, salt, and pepper.
  • Vegetables: This recipe uses lettuce, cabbage, and carrots to add freshness and crunch. You can adjust the vegetables to your taste or use what you have on hand.

Homemade Crispy Fish Burger

No ratings yet
Prep: 10 minutes
Cook: 10 minutes
Total: 20 minutes
Servings: 4
Author: Juri Austin
This homemade fish burger is a big hit with my family! Crispy fish, fresh vegetables, and a creamy egg mayo sauce make it so satisfying. If you love fish, this is a must-try!
Fish burger served on a plate.

Ingredients
  

  • 4 burger buns
  • head cabbage
  • 4 lettuce leaves
  • ½ carrot
For the fried fish
  • 4 fish fillets of your choice, Aji, cod, pollock, salmon, or any firm fish works well.
  • salt and pepper, to taste
  • all-purpose flour, as needed
  • 1 egg, beaten
  • panko breadcrumbs, as needed
  • vegetable oil, for pan-frying
For the egg mayo sauce
  • 2 boiled eggs
  • 4 Tbsp mayonnaise
  • 1 tsp vinegar
  • 1 tsp sugar
  • salt and pepper, to taste

Instructions
 

  1. Prepare the vegetables: Shred the lettuce, cabbage, and carrot.
  2. Coat the fish: Season the fish fillets with salt and pepper. Coat each fillet with flour, dip into the beaten eggs, then coat with panko breadcrumbs.
  3. Pan-fry the fish: Heat the vegetable oil in a frying pan over medium heat. Pan-fry the fish until golden and crispy on both sides. Make sure the fish is fully cooked through.
  4. Make the egg mayo sauce: Mash the boiled eggs with a fork, then mix with mayonnaise, vinegar, sugar, salt, and pepper.
  5. Toast the buns: Lightly toast the burger buns until warm and slightly crisp.
  6. Assemble the burgers: Spread a little mayonnaise on the burger buns, add the shredded vegetables, crispy fish, and plenty of sauce. Top with the other half of the bun and serve. Enjoy!
